
Israeli defensive forces (IDF) announced extensive changes in their intelligence training, which makes the Arab language and Islamic studies mandatory for all its officers in the wing.
Changes come in response to the failure of news, which occurred around 7 October 2023, IDF confirmed the Jewish report Syndicate (JNS).

What was the situation before?
Previously, training in Arab language and Islamic studies was not compulsory for intelligence units. Now the training is mandatory for all intelligence workers, including those in technological roles that have not previously been associated with Arab language or Islamic study.
When a military unit for Arabic language was set up
In 1986, a military unit was created in Israel, which supported Arab teaching in schools, but in 2001 was dissolved in budget cuts, mentions the research article Taylor and Francis called “Military Intelligence and Securitization of Arabic expertise in Israel: The boundaries and curse of unintended consequences”.
